It improves balance, posture and coordination.
Regular cycling helps in improving your balance, posture and coordination. Riding a bike helps keep your core engaged, which can help with overall stability and prevent back pain. Cycling also improves flexibility and range of motion in the hips and ankles, helping you stay nimble on your feet.

Improve Sleep Cycles
Studies have shown that cycling can help improve sleep cycles. Vigorous exercise helps to tire you out, and the fresh air from being outside is known to help people fall asleep faster and get a better night’s sleep.

Cycling is easier than running.
This one is definitely true! Cycling is a great option if you’re looking for a low-impact workout. Unlike running, cycling is gentle on your joints and easy on your muscles.
When someone isn’t used to working out or might be struggling with joint pain for example, starting off by cycling every day as an activity might be the best way to ease into things before slowly adding in more strenuous exercises down the road. Safety Tips When Cycling Outside
When doing outdoor activities, it is significant that you use caution and be aware of your surroundings. Make sure to stay hydrated, dress appropriately for the weather, and be cautious when near traffic or other dangers.
Also, if you’re going to be out in the sun for an extended period of time, make sure to use sunscreen and drink plenty of water! Sun exposure can lead to skin cancer risk.
